=== modified file 'dhis-2/dhis-web/dhis-web-dashboard-integration/src/main/resources/org/hisp/dhis/dashboard/i18n_module.properties' --- dhis-2/dhis-web/dhis-web-dashboard-integration/src/main/resources/org/hisp/dhis/dashboard/i18n_module.properties 2011-06-14 19:13:54 +0000 +++ dhis-2/dhis-web/dhis-web-dashboard-integration/src/main/resources/org/hisp/dhis/dashboard/i18n_module.properties 2011-08-03 12:14:53 +0000 @@ -31,4 +31,7 @@ read = Read confirm_delete_message = Are you sure you want to delete the message? unread_messages = unread messages -unread_message = unread message \ No newline at end of file +unread_message = unread message +discard = Discard +enter_subject = Please enter a subject +enter_text = Please enter text \ No newline at end of file === modified file 'dhis-2/dhis-web/dhis-web-dashboard-integration/src/main/webapp/dhis-web-dashboard-integration/javascript/message.js' --- dhis-2/dhis-web/dhis-web-dashboard-integration/src/main/webapp/dhis-web-dashboard-integration/javascript/message.js 2011-06-22 18:29:52 +0000 +++ dhis-2/dhis-web/dhis-web-dashboard-integration/src/main/webapp/dhis-web-dashboard-integration/javascript/message.js 2011-08-03 12:14:53 +0000 @@ -1,3 +1,11 @@ + +var selectedOrganisationUnits = []; + +function selectOrganisationUnit__( units ) +{ + selectedOrganisationUnits = units; +} + function removeMessage( id ) { removeItem( id, "", i18n_confirm_delete_message, "removeMessage.action" ); @@ -7,3 +15,23 @@ { window.location.href = "readMessage.action?id=" + id; } + +function validateMessage() +{ + var subject = $( '#subject' ).val(); + var text = $( '#text' ).val(); + + if ( subject == null || subject.trim() == '' ) + { + setHeaderMessage( i18n_enter_subject ); + return false; + } + + if ( text == null || text.trim() == '' ) + { + setHeaderMessage( i18n_enter_text ); + return false; + } + + return true; +} === modified file 'dhis-2/dhis-web/dhis-web-dashboard-integration/src/main/webapp/dhis-web-dashboard-integration/readMessage.vm' --- dhis-2/dhis-web/dhis-web-dashboard-integration/src/main/webapp/dhis-web-dashboard-integration/readMessage.vm 2011-08-03 10:05:08 +0000 +++ dhis-2/dhis-web/dhis-web-dashboard-integration/src/main/webapp/dhis-web-dashboard-integration/readMessage.vm 2011-08-03 11:03:01 +0000 @@ -1,17 +1,4 @@ -
- - - -
- -

$encoder.htmlEncode( $message.message.subject )

- -
$encoder.htmlEncode( $message.message.sender.name )  -$format.formatDate( $message.messageDate )
- -
$encoder.htmlEncode( $message.message.text )
- + +
+ + + +
+ +

$encoder.htmlEncode( $message.message.subject )

+ +
$encoder.htmlEncode( $message.message.sender.name )  +$format.formatDate( $message.messageDate )
+ +
$encoder.htmlEncode( $message.message.text )
+ === modified file 'dhis-2/dhis-web/dhis-web-dashboard-integration/src/main/webapp/dhis-web-dashboard-integration/sendFeedback.vm' --- dhis-2/dhis-web/dhis-web-dashboard-integration/src/main/webapp/dhis-web-dashboard-integration/sendFeedback.vm 2011-06-14 19:13:54 +0000 +++ dhis-2/dhis-web/dhis-web-dashboard-integration/src/main/webapp/dhis-web-dashboard-integration/sendFeedback.vm 2011-08-03 12:14:53 +0000 @@ -1,24 +1,28 @@ +

$i18n.getString( "write_new_feedback" )

-
+ - + - + +
$i18n.getString( "subject" )
$i18n.getString( "text" )
-
=== modified file 'dhis-2/dhis-web/dhis-web-dashboard-integration/src/main/webapp/dhis-web-dashboard-integration/sendMessage.vm' --- dhis-2/dhis-web/dhis-web-dashboard-integration/src/main/webapp/dhis-web-dashboard-integration/sendMessage.vm 2011-06-14 19:13:54 +0000 +++ dhis-2/dhis-web/dhis-web-dashboard-integration/src/main/webapp/dhis-web-dashboard-integration/sendMessage.vm 2011-08-03 12:14:53 +0000 @@ -1,7 +1,11 @@ +

$i18n.getString( "write_new_message" )

- + @@ -14,18 +18,18 @@ - + - + +
$i18n.getString( "subject" )
$i18n.getString( "text" )
-